Toyohashi City General Gymnasium, Indoor sports venue in Jinnoshinden-chō, Japan
Toyohashi City General Gymnasium is a sports facility comprising two arenas: a main hall spanning roughly 3,450 square meters and a secondary hall covering about 1,180 square meters. The space is designed to accommodate different sporting events and competitions simultaneously.
The facility opened in 1989 and became a central venue for sports competitions in Aichi Prefecture. Since its establishment, it has remained an important sports destination for the region.
This gymnasium serves as the home court for the San-en NeoPhoenix basketball team, which competes in Japan's professional B.League. The team draws local fans who gather here regularly for games throughout the season.
The facility offers 410 parking spaces with 12 spaces reserved for visitors with disabilities, making it accessible by car. When planning a visit, note that the venue closes on Mondays.
The venue features flexible seating arrangements that can accommodate around 3,000 spectators across two levels. This adaptability allows the space to be reconfigured based on the type of event and expected attendance.
